蜘蛛池搭建服务器配置:揭开SEO蜘蛛技术的秘密

编辑:新程序已上线 时间:2025-03-19 08:55:26

什么是蜘蛛池?

在SEO领域中,“蜘蛛池”是指一个由多个虚拟服务器组成的网络,这些服务器用来优化搜索引擎蜘蛛的抓取效率。通过创建一个高效的蜘蛛池,网站主可以控制搜索引擎的爬虫对其网站的抓取频率和抓取深度,从而在一定程度上提升自己网站的排名。蜘蛛池的搭建涉及到多种服务器配置和技术,是诸多网站管理员和SEO专家追求的高效工具。

为什么选择搭建蜘蛛池?

搭建蜘蛛池的主要目的在于提高网站在搜索引擎中的可见性,加速内容的索引过程。搜索引擎爬虫会定期访问各个网站来获取新内容并更新索引,因此合理配置蜘蛛池能够有效提升抓取的频率。此外,蜘蛛池还能够帮助分散风险,避免因频繁变更内容而引起的IP封禁。

服务器配置的基本要求

在搭建蜘蛛池时,服务器的配置是至关重要的。以下是一些基本的服务器配置要求:

  • CPU:选择多核心的CPU,以提高并发抓取的能力。
  • 内存:较大的内存可以支持更多的线程同时运行。
  • 带宽:选择高带宽的网络,以保证数据传输的效率。
  • 存储空间:足够的存储空间可以保存大量的抓取数据和网页快照。

常用的服务器软件

在搭建蜘蛛池时,选择合适的服务器软件也是至关重要的。以下是一些常用的软件选项:

  • Apache:开源的Web服务器软件,稳定且配置简单。
  • Nginx:高性能的Web服务器,适合处理大量并发请求,常用于反向代理。
  • MySQL:用于管理存储的抓取数据,可以轻松进行数据查询和分析。

蜘蛛池的搭建步骤

下面将详细介绍蜘蛛池的搭建步骤:

步骤1:选择合适的服务器

选择合适的服务器提供商至关重要。可以考虑云服务,如AWS、DigitalOcean或阿里云,根据需要的配置选择合适的套餐。

步骤2:安装操作系统

根据选择的服务器类型,安装Linux操作系统,例如Ubuntu或CentOS。这些系统稳定性高,资源占用少。

步骤3:安装Web服务器和数据库

安装Apache或Nginx作为Web服务器,同时安装MySQL等数据库管理系统来存储和管理抓取的数据。新程序KD0文章测试

步骤4:配置爬虫软件

选择一个适合的爬虫框架,如Scrapy或BeautifulSoup。根据项目需求配置爬虫的抓取逻辑、页面解析和数据存储方法。

步骤5:设置代理服务器

为了保持抓取的匿名性和安全性,可以设置代理服务器。这有助于防止被目标网站屏蔽IP。

步骤6:定期维护

搭建完成后,需要定期检查和维护服务器,确保抓取任务的顺利进行。监测服务器负载,及时处理异常情况。

蜘蛛池的优化技巧

搭建完蜘蛛池后,通过以下方法进一步优化抓取效果:

  • 合理配置抓取规则:定制化抓取规则可以大大提升效率,避免无关内容的抓取。
  • 缓存机制:使用缓存来存储已抓取的数据,减少重复抓取,提高速度。
  • 多线程抓取:通过多线程技术来提高同时抓取的数量,充分利用服务器的资源。

监控与数据分析

建立蜘蛛池后,监控抓取的效果和数据分析是确保其高效运作的重要环节。可以使用Analytics工具、日志分析工具等,对爬虫的抓取情况进行全面分析,从而优化抓取策略。新程序Rx5r文章测试

法律与道德问题

在实施蜘蛛池抓取时,务必遵守法律法规和道德规范。某些网站在其robots.txt文件中明确禁止爬虫抓取,遵从这些规范是网站管理员应尽的责任。对网站的请求频率、内容抓取等也应适当控制,以避免对目标网站造成负担。

结语

蜘蛛池的搭建与配置是一项复杂的技术工作,但通过合理的服务器配置与科学的抓取策略,能够显著提升网站在搜索引擎中的表现。随着SEO技术的不断发展,掌握蜘蛛池相关知识与配置技巧,极有助于提升网络营销的效果,获取更多的流量和潜在客户。

无论是在技术实施还是策略制定方面,蜘蛛池的搭建都需要不断学习和优化。希望本文对您搭建高效的蜘蛛池,提升SEO效果有所帮助。